What made Tradewinds 2 special was its accessibility. Unlike the spreadsheet-heavy simulators of the time, Tradewinds 2 used visual cues, charming 2D art, and a straightforward interface. Prices fluctuated based on events (famines, wars, holidays), and you could haggle with merchants. Combat was turn-based, with you commanding a ship that could fire cannons, ram, or attempt to board enemy vessels. tradewinds 2 play online

Moreover, Tradewinds 2 was part of a lost ecosystem—the era of the "premium Flash game." You could play the first hour for free online, then purchase a key to unlock the full game. That model has largely been replaced by mobile free-to-play with microtransactions, a far less generous system. So, can you still play Tradewinds 2 online ? The answer is nuanced: not in the original sense, through a standard browser with a single click.
